App Store

17+ 年龄分级和 App 销售范围的近期改动

为给开发者创造更多机会,我们与韩国政府进行了合作,以期在韩国 App Store 中提供更多 App。此外,为确保我们的全球年龄分级系统能够持续为儿童提供安全的 App Store 使用环境,包含频繁/强烈的模拟赌博内容的 App 将于 2019 年 8 月 20 日起在所有国家和地区纳入 17+ 分级。

WWDC19

WWDC19 视频现已配有字幕脚本

充分利用字幕脚本来快速探索和共享 WWDC19 视频展示的信息。您可以按关键词搜索,以查看视频中提及到关键词的所有段落,并直接跳转到相关时间,甚至还能就某一时间节点共享视频。

观看今年的 WWDC 视频

App Store

App Store 链接更新

现在,从 App Store 生成的 app 链接会以 apps.apple.com 开头。以 iTunes.apple.com 开头的原有链接将继续正常运作,并会自动转跳至 apps.apple.com 域。

SDK

了解 Apple 平台的新功能

Xcode 11 beta 版包含适用于 iOS 13、watchOS 6、tvOS 13 和 macOS Catalina 的 SDK,可助您打造流畅、智能且引人入胜的使用体验。

进一步了解

SwiftUI

SwiftUI

SwiftUI 是一种在所有 Apple 平台上构建用户界面的创新方式,让您能编写较少的代码,创建更出色的 app。SwiftUI 采用简单易懂、编写方式自然的声明式 Swift 语法,可无缝支持新的 Xcode 设计工具,让您的代码与设计保持高度同步。SwiftUI 原生支持“动态字体”、“深色模式”、本地化和辅助功能——第一行您写出的 SwiftUI 代码,就已经是您编写过的、功能最强大的 UI 代码。

进一步了解

适用于 Mac 的 iPad App

将您的 iPad App 带入 Mac

现在,您可以基于自己当前的 iPad app,轻松地创建原生 Mac app。您仅需要 beta 版 Xcode 11,就万事齐备。您的 Mac 和 iPad app 共用相同的项目和源代码,因此您所做的任何更改都可转化到这两个平台中。您新创建的 Mac app 会以原生方式运行,使用与专为 Mac 构建的 app 相同的框架、资源,甚至运行时环境。

进一步了解

Sign In with Apple

Sign In with Apple

现在,用户可以使用 Apple ID,甚至是面容 ID 或触控 ID 来登录您的 app 和网站。“Sign In with Apple”包含多项隐私与安全功能,是用户设置帐户并立即上手的绝佳帮手。

进一步了解

机器学习

机器学习

Core ML 3 能够无缝地使用 CPU、GPU 和神经网络引擎,提供出色的性能和效率,让您将最新的先进模型整合到自己的 app 中。全新的 Create ML app 让您无需具备任何机器学习专业知识,也能构建、训练和部署机器学习模型。您可以充分利用设备端模型训练和定制模型库。

进一步了解

增强现实

增强现实

ARKit 3 提供了出色的人物感知能力,让您能够将人物动作整合到自己的 app 中:全新的 People Occlusion 拥有多种功能,包括让增强现实内容无比逼真地从现实世界中的人物前后通过等等。借助 Reality Composer (功能强大的新 app,可帮助您轻松打造 AR 体验) 和 RealityKit (全新的高级增强现实框架),您可以轻松创建原型并打造 AR 体验。

进一步了解

Siri

Siri

利用 Siri 的最新改进,通过跟进问题、额外的快捷指令自定和音频内容播放,提供交互式语音体验。您的 app 可以通知 Siri 用户的预约时间,让 Siri 提醒他们办理登记、在“地图”中提供导航,以及将事件添加到“日历”等等。使用 iOS 13 中内建的“快捷指令”app,用户可以更快捷地查找、使用和组合快捷指令。

进一步了解

App Store

反馈助理

现在,您可以使用 iOS 和 Mac 的原生“反馈助理”app,向 Apple 提交开发者反馈和文件错误报告;这款 app 的功能包括设备端自动诊断、远程错误归档、更详细的错误表单以及更多的错误状态。此外,您还可以使用“反馈助理”网站。“反馈助理”现已取代 Bug Reporter。

进一步了解 (英文)

Mac 软件的公证要求

使用 Developer ID 进行签名的 Mac app、安装器软件包和内核扩展也必须获得 Apple 的公证,才能在 macOS Catalina 上运行。这样,无论用户从任何渠道下载并运行相关软件,看到精简明了的“门禁”界面,都会给他们更多信心,确信那不是恶意软件。

进一步了解

App Store

《App Store 审核指南》内容更新

App Store 致力于为每位用户提供出色的商店体验。为了继续为用户提供安全的体验并为开发者创造取得成功的绝佳机会,我们有时需要更新《App Store 审核指南》。

macOS Mojave

新的公证要求

通过由 Apple 签名和公证所有软件 (无论是在 App Store 上或在 App Store 外发布),我们正和开发者一起共同打造出更安全可靠的 Mac 用户体验。macOS 10.14.5 公开发布后,我们要求首次创建 Developer ID 证书的所有开发者提交他们的 app 进行公证;所有新建或更新的内核扩展亦需接受公证。无论用户在何处获取软件,变得更为精简的“门禁”界面都能让用户知道他们下载和运行的不是恶意软件,进一步提高用户对您软件的信心。

了解如何对您的软件进行公证

App Store

即将实行的 App Store 提交要求

如今,全球超过 80% 的设备在运行 iOS 12。请将您的 app 与 iOS 所带来的最新优势无缝集成,以确保您的 app 提供卓越的用户体验。自 2019 年 3 月 27 日起,所有面向 iPhone 或 iPad 的新 app 和 app 更新 (包括通用 app) 都必须使用 iOS 12.1 SDK 或更新版本构建,并支持 iPhone XS Max 或 12.9 英寸 iPad Pro (第三代)。并需要提供针对这些设备的屏幕快照。面向 Apple Watch 的所有新 app 和 app 更新都需要使用 watchOS 5.1 SDK 或更新版本构建,并支持 Apple Watch Series 4。

了解内存管理的变更
iOS 12 和 tvOS 12 要求 app 比以前更有效地使用内存。如果您在降低 app 内存要求方面遇到困难,请联系我们 (英文),请求为您的 app 使用 iOS 11 式的内存管理。

进一步了解如何准备您的 app

App Store

提供新的优惠,推广您的订阅项目

包含自动续期订阅的 app 很快将能为现有或之前的订阅顾客提供折扣价格。订阅优惠可帮您赢回已取消订阅的用户;或以特价促进订阅的升级率。准备好您的优惠措施,以在这项功能正式提供时占得先机。请下载最新的 Xcode 10.2 beta 版,实施新的 StoreKit API,并在最新 beta 版本的 iOS 12.2、macOS 10.14.4 和 tvOS 12.2 上进行测试。

了解如何提供订阅优惠

设计资源

新的设计资源现已推出

确保您的 iOS 和 watchOS app 能够继续提供出色的用户体验。您可以利用新的 Siri 快捷指令设计模板、适用于 watchOS 的 SF Compact Rounded (紧缩圆体) 字体,以及适用于 Adobe XD 的 watchOS 设计套件。您还可以获得最新设计模板来打造 iOS 主屏幕、通知、Widget 和主屏幕快速操作。

进一步了解 (英文)

Salesforce

Salesforce SDK 现已针对 iOS 进行了优化

为 iPhone 和 iPad 创建引人注目的原生 app,并将这些 app 连接到 Salesforce 平台。这款重新构建的 SDK 针对 Swift 和 iOS 12 进行了优化,将最新的现代编程与强大的开发者工具结合在一起,旨在改善客户体验。

开始使用 SDK (英文)